Perhaps it’s unfair, as this is now my third Rooney novel, to compare CWF to her other works. Of the three, it is my least favorite.
But, as a debut novel, it shows all of the promise of what I’ve come to love Rooney for: complicated characters, beautiful prose and realistic dialogue. Maybe too much of too realistic this time since I found every character to be a bit insufferable.
